Economic Duress
Coercion involving threats to a person’s business or financial condition that compel the person to act against their will in entering a contract.
Voluntary Choice
The concept of making decisions freely, without coercion, often discussed in contexts of contract law and ethics.
Legitimate Alternatives
Viable and lawful options or solutions that are considered acceptable within a given context or situation.
Duty
A legal or moral obligation required to be fulfilled by an individual or organization.
